Versatility and Styling Options

In terms of versatility, the ANIEKIN Hair Dryer includes both a diffuser and a concentrator attachment, allowing for more tailored styling options. The diffuser is particularly beneficial for users with curly or wavy hair, providing even and gentle airflow for styling without frizz. The concentrator attachment helps direct the airflow for precision styling, making it suitable for various hairstyles.

The Licoseam Hair Dryer, while lacking a diffuser, compensates with two heat and two speed settings, along with a Cool Shot button. This allows users to lock in styles effectively, catering to different hair types. However, for those seeking a broader range of styling options, the ANIEKIN may be more appealing due to its additional attachments.

Safety Features

Both hair dryers include safety features designed to protect users during operation. The ANIEKIN Hair Dryer incorporates overheat protection and an automatic power-off function, enhancing its safety profile. Additionally, its low magnetic wave structure technology reduces radiation, providing peace of mind for users concerned about long-term exposure.

The Licoseam Hair Dryer also prioritizes safety with an ALCI plug, which helps prevent electric hazards, particularly in damp environments like bathrooms. It features dual thermal devices to mitigate fire hazards if the dryer is accidentally covered. Both models offer essential safety functionalities, but the specific features may cater to different user preferences.
